#9d350d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9d350d is composed of 61.6% red, 20.8% green and 5.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 66.2% magenta, 91.7% yellow and 38.4% black. It has a hue angle of 16.7 degrees, a saturation of 84.7% and a lightness of 33.3%. #9d350d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6a1a with #3b0000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

● #9d350d color description : Dark orange [Brown tone].
#9d350d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9d350d has RGB values of R:157, G:53, B:13 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.66, Y:0.92,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 10302733.

Shades and Tints of #9d350d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0401 is the darkest color, while #fffbf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#9d350d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#555555 is the less saturated color, while #a43206 is the most saturated one.
